This is the moment the windscreen of a Philippines supply boat shattered during an attack by the Chinese coast guard in the South China Sea. The ship was trying to reach the remote Second Thomas Shoal, a reef that legally belongs to the Philippines but is claimed by Beijing. The Chinese coast guard were dispatched to stop the mission, firing water cannon at the Philippines vessel and causing the windscreen to explode inwards, showering the crew with water and broken glass.
It is not the first time the two nations have clashed over the shoal, and is made more dangerous by the fact that the US and Philippines have a defence pact, meaning the US will get involved if its ally is attacked. #Philippines #china #ship
